açafata

Portuguese

Etymology

From açafate.

Pronunciation

 
  • (Brazil) IPA(key): /a.saˈfa.tɐ/
    • (Southern Brazil) IPA(key): /a.saˈfa.ta/

  • Rhymes: -atɐ
  • Hyphenation: a‧ça‧fa‧ta

Noun

açafata f (plural açafatas)

  1. lady-in-waiting (court lady who was in charge of the clothes of the ladies of the royal family and delivered them to a bagger)
